Abstract

Synthesis of heterocyclic amid derivative (cyclohexanecarbox-amide) by the reacting
four-compound [Formaldehyde], [N-(phenethyl)formamide], [Cyclohexanecarboxylic
acid], and [Creatinine] as amine source. This reaction is practical extension of (Ugi
reaction). The derivatives have been performed with other catalytic agents under temp
(-10°C) and the organic synthesis was monitories by TLC [thin layer chromatography]
and the formation of final compound proofed by Nuclear Magnetic Resonance Spectra
[
1HNMR] [13CNMR] BRUKER (500MHz, CDL3), (125MHz, CDL3 and Infra-Red spectra [FTIR] (shimadzu).
